Soil Permeability Apparatus – Efficient Testing of Soil Water Flow Characteristics
The Soil Permeability Apparatus is a highly reliable setup used to determine the permeability (coefficient of permeability) of soil, particularly in clay, silt, and sandy materials. It helps evaluate water flow characteristics through soil, which is crucial for geotechnical design, groundwater studies, dam engineering, and foundation stability assessments.
This apparatus is available in both Constant Head and Falling Head configurations for a wide range of soil types.
